GITHUB是什么水果花束

不及物动词 其他 25

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    GITHUB并不是水果花束,它实际上是一个面向开发者的基于Web的版本控制仓库和源代码管理工具。它是全球最大的代码托管平台,通过提供版本控制功能和协作工具,使开发者能够更好地管理和跟踪软件项目的代码变更。

    GITHUB允许开发者在同一个代码库中对代码进行编辑、提交、复查和合并。它使用Git作为版本控制系统,Git是一种分布式版本控制系统,能够有效地管理和跟踪代码的变更,提供了强大的代码合并和冲突解决工具。

    GITHUB提供了一个基于Web的用户界面,用户可以通过浏览器直接访问代码库,查看代码、提交问题、提出建议和共享意见。开发者可以使用GITHUB来托管和共享自己的开源项目,也可以在GITHUB上浏览和贡献他人的项目。

    除了代码托管功能外,GITHUB还提供了一些其他的特性。例如,它允许开发者创建一个Wiki页面来记录项目的文档和说明;它还支持项目的问题跟踪功能,开发者可以在GITHUB上创建问题并进行沟通和讨论。

    总之,GITHUB是一个旨在帮助开发者管理和协作开发软件项目的工具,它通过提供版本控制、协作和代码管理功能,让开发者能够更加高效地进行软件开发工作。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    GitHub不是一种水果花束,而是一个面向开发者的代码托管平台。下面是关于GitHub的五个要点:

    1. 代码托管平台:GitHub是一个基于Web的代码托管平台,它允许开发者创建和存储他们的代码库。开发者可以将自己的项目代码上传到GitHub,并与其他开发者分享,进行版本控制和协作开发。

    2. 版本控制功能:GitHub使用Git作为版本控制系统,在开发过程中,开发者可以记录和管理代码的不同版本,以追踪代码的变化和修改历史,并且可以轻松地切换到不同版本,回滚代码等操作。

    3. 协作开发平台:GitHub提供了丰富的协作功能,开发者可以邀请他人加入自己的项目,共同开发和维护代码。开发者可以通过创建分支,提交代码,并通过合并请求和代码审查等功能进行合作。

    4. 社交化平台:GitHub不仅仅是一个代码托管平台,还是一个社交化平台。开发者可以在GitHub上关注其他开发者,点赞和评论他人的项目,提问和回答技术问题,参与开源社区的讨论和活动。

    5. 开源项目库:GitHub上有大量的开源项目,开源项目是指开发者将自己的项目代码开放给其他人查看、使用和修改的项目。通过GitHub,开发者可以浏览和发现各种开源项目,学习和借鉴他人的代码,也可以贡献自己的代码给开源社区。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Github并不是水果花束,它实际上是一个基于Web的托管服务,用于版本控制和协作开发。它是全球最大的开源代码库和版本控制系统之一,被广泛用于团队合作开发、个人项目管理和代码共享等方面。GitHub提供了强大的代码版本控制功能,使开发人员能够轻松地跟踪和管理项目的变化。接下来,我将详细介绍GitHub的操作流程和一些常用方法。

    ## 什么是版本控制

    版本控制系统(Version Control System,简称VCS)是一种记录文件变化的管理系统。它在软件开发中起到重要的作用,可以帮助开发人员跟踪文件的修改历史、协作开发、回滚到旧版本等。

    在没有版本控制系统的情况下,开发人员通常会手动复制和备份文件,或者给文件添加时间戳来记录变化。然而,这种方法很容易出错,而且无法有效地跟踪和协作。版本控制系统的出现解决了这个问题,使我们能够更好地管理和追踪文件的变化。

    ## Git和GitHub

    Git是一种分布式版本控制系统,由Linux之父Linus Torvalds于2005年创建。Git提供了一种轻量级、快速和灵活的版本控制方案,可以在本地进行操作,而无需依赖于网络连接。

    GitHub则是基于Git的代码托管服务,由Tom Preston-Werner、Chris Wanstrath和PJ Hyett于2008年创建。GitHub提供了集中式的代码托管平台,使开发人员可以将代码存储在云端,方便团队协作和代码共享。

    Git和GitHub被广泛应用于开源社区和商业项目中,成为了开发人员必备的工具之一。

    ## GitHub的基本操作流程

    下面将介绍GitHub的基本操作流程,包括创建仓库、克隆仓库、添加和提交文件、分支管理、合并代码等。

    ### 1. 创建仓库

    首先,你需要在GitHub上创建一个仓库,用于存储你的代码和文件。在GitHub的主页上点击”New”按钮,填写仓库名称、描述等信息,并选择是否公开或私有。点击”Create repository”按钮,即可创建一个新的仓库。

    ### 2. 克隆仓库

    创建完仓库后,你需要将其克隆到本地。在本地的命令行或图形化界面中,使用”git clone”命令克隆仓库。例如,使用以下命令克隆一个仓库:

    “`
    git clone https://github.com/your_username/your_repository.git
    “`

    ### 3. 添加和提交文件

    在本地进行代码编写和修改后,你可以使用以下命令将修改的文件添加到暂存区:

    “`
    git add file_name
    “`

    然后,使用以下命令将暂存区的文件提交到仓库:

    “`
    git commit -m “commit message”
    “`

    提交消息应该清晰明了,描述你进行的修改或添加的内容。

    ### 4. 分支管理

    在GitHub上,分支是用于实现并行开发和代码管理的重要工具。你可以创建新的分支来开发新功能或修复bug,以免影响主分支上的稳定代码。

    首先,你可以使用以下命令查看当前仓库的分支列表:

    “`
    git branch
    “`

    然后,使用以下命令创建新的分支:

    “`
    git branch new_branch
    “`

    接下来,切换到新的分支上进行开发:

    “`
    git checkout new_branch
    “`

    在新的分支上进行代码修改和提交,不会影响主分支。

    ### 5. 合并代码

    当你在新的分支上开发完新的功能或修复了bug后,你可以将这些修改的代码合并到主分支上。

    首先,切换回主分支:

    “`
    git checkout main
    “`

    然后,使用以下命令将新的分支合并到主分支:

    “`
    git merge new_branch
    “`

    如果存在冲突,你需要解决冲突后再次提交。

    ### 6. 提交到远程仓库

    最后,你可以使用以下命令将本地仓库的修改推送到远程仓库:

    “`
    git push origin main
    “`

    这将把你本地的修改同步到GitHub上的远程仓库。

    以上就是GitHub的基本操作流程,通过这些操作,你可以更好地管理和协作开发项目。

    ## 总结

    GitHub是一个基于Web的代码托管服务,提供了强大的版本控制和协作开发功能。它使用Git作为底层版本控制系统,允许开发人员在本地进行代码修改和管理,并将其推送到云端供团队协作。GitHub的基本操作流程包括创建仓库、克隆仓库、添加和提交文件、分支管理和合并代码等。通过GitHub,开发人员可以轻松地跟踪和管理项目的变化,提高开发效率和代码质量。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部